What I've Learned from Softball

Hi all! Here are the top five things I've learned from my first season in playing softball.

1. You will get hit by the ball. Numerous times. Maybe even in the face! It'll hurt, and while having bruises the size of a softball isn't fun, you'll survive. Probably. :P

2. Keep your eye on the ball! At all times! It doesn't matter if you are batting or catching, if you keep your eye on the ball you won't miss, I promise.

3. Swing with violence. (As long as you can keep your eye on the ball...) it's the surefire way to hit the ball hard. Just think of something that really ticks you off, and GET MEAN!

4. Don't be afraid of the ball. It's difficult, I know, but try not to be scared of the ball. This usually comes from practice, and being hit at least 25 times by the ball.

5. Love your teammates. There's no "I" in "team" (but there is in "win"! Haha!), so just stick with your teammates. United we stand, and divided we fall.
